The Bridge desk by WEWOOD, designed by Christophe de Sousa in 2018, was created from a reference strongly connected to the city of Porto and its architectural identity.
The design takes inspiration from the six bridges crossing the Douro River, translating their forms, structure and meaning into a desk with a contemporary and minimalist language.
The surfaces feature soft lines and rounded transitions, while the combination of wood and steel creates an elegant contrast between material warmth and structural precision.
A Tribute to Porto’s Bridges
The most distinctive element of Bridge is represented by the steel arches connecting the legs, a direct reference to the structures of Porto’s bridges.
These metal details discreetly interrupt the continuity of the wood, creating a distinctive visual element without compromising the overall essential character of the desk.
The result is a composition in which form and structure interact naturally: wood provides warmth and elegance, while steel introduces a more architectural and industrial reference.

Features
- Brand: WEWOOD
- Model: Bridge Desk
- Type: Desk
- Designer: Christophe de Sousa
- Year: 2018
- Materials: Wood and steel
- Available wood species: Oak or walnut
- Structural details: Steel arches between the legs
- Inspiration: Bridges of the city of Porto
- Design: Minimalist and contemporary
- Use: Indoor
- Suitable for: Home office, studio and office

Dimensions
- Width: 120 cm
- Depth: 71 cm
- Height: 74 cm
Designer
Christophe de Sousa is a French-Portuguese designer born in France in 1979. His education and professional career have been deeply influenced by the encounter between different cultures, travel and the observation of details.
A graduate in Industrial Design from Lusíada University of Porto, he has collaborated with companies from various sectors, developing a design approach in which form and function are analyzed as inseparable parts of the same creative process.
